History provides sobering examples of companies that failed despite their age. Kodak dominated photography for over a century, but collapsed when digital technology emerged because it couldn't adapt its core offerings. Blockbuster operated for decades as the video rental leader, yet Netflix's superior service model made their brand irrelevant practically overnight.
